Baqiyyah Conway is a scholar working on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Baqiyyah Conway has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, 8 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 6 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Baqiyyah Conway’s work include Diabetes Management and Research (11 papers), Diabetes, Cardiovascular Risks, and Lipoproteins (7 papers) and Diabetes and associated disorders (6 papers). Baqiyyah Conway is often cited by papers focused on Diabetes Management and Research (11 papers), Diabetes, Cardiovascular Risks, and Lipoproteins (7 papers) and Diabetes and associated disorders (6 papers). Baqiyyah Conway collaborates with scholars based in United States, Japan and Australia. Baqiyyah Conway's co-authors include Antônio Renê, Trevor J. Orchard, Tina Costacou, Rachel G. Miller, S. F. Kelsey, Dustin Long, Alan Ducatman, Roger G. Evans, Linda F. Fried and Motao Zhu and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, PLoS ONE and Diabetes Care.
